Piurared located at piurared.site is a fake online store claiming to sell Charmin toilet papers, hand sanitizers, and personal protective equipment(PPE). Online shoppers run the risk of receiving counterfeit goods or nothing at all from the same store. Unsatisfied online users who have shopped on the untrustworthy website are asked to contact their bank or financial institution to have their transactions canceled and money refunded.
